Ripped off by Interval International
I purchased a Getaway from Intwrval International for $1700 to stay at the Hyatt in Key West from Sept. 9th to the 15th.
Due to hurricane Irma could not go. Alligent cancelled our flight and refunded our money. Interval will not give us a refund or credit. They are offering us a vacation certificate.
We already have 2 in our account for no reason at all and find them very hard to use. These cert do not have a value any where near $1700.
Interval has a week open 12/10/2017 at the Hyatt in Key West that they should but will not rebook us into. We truly feel like Interval is ripping us off!
